Mary Jane McCarty's custom-made pillows and home accessories are done with a creative flair! Crafted from antique textiles - rare antique toiles, elegant brocades or perhaps just the perfect silk - they will put the finishing touch on your decor. Pillows can be designed for any style of interior, using your fabric or textile pieces from Mary Jane's extensive collection.

Mary Jane has two decades experience of working with retail stores and with interior designers. Over the years Mary Jane has done work for such celebrated designers as Michael Smith and Kathryn Ireland in Los Angeles, Bunny Williams, John Rosselli and Caroline Wharton in New York City, and Fury Design and Kathleen Jamieson in Philadelphia and Princeton, New Jersey’s Dennison and Dampier. When given a design direction, she can create a signature collection of pillows and accessories to complement and enhance a client’s home.
